Getting them to drink water

Getting them to drink water

I've been having a hard time getting my 5 year old to see how important it is to drink something more than just soda all the time, but it has not been easy... He's pretty stubborn.  Any tips would be appreciated, thanks in advance!

Don't buy soda.

I know this seems simplistic,  but really,  he's 5.  If you decide to keep buying soda,  tell him from now on he can choose one soda a day,  whenever he wants it that's fine.  Otherwise,  provide a bunch of really nice juices,  gatorade,  lemons and limes to make "citrus water" - wow that's good - a glass of ice water,  a teaspoon of sugar and a 1/4 lime or lemon squeezed in.

When he's 17 it would be hard to get him to drink what you want him to,  but he's only 5 - it's easy.

I'd omit soda altogether--it's bad for their teeth.  And it's better to eat fruits than drink fruit juice.  I like the suggestion of squeezing citrus fruits into water.

If water was all he had to drink, he would drink it.
